EVS-EN ISO 12216:2002

Small craft - Windows, portlights, hatches, dead-lights and doors - Strength and watertightness requirements

Although the standard’s status is withdrawn, it still has the presumption of conformity in the meaning of regulation 2013/53/EU and conformance with the regulation ’s requirements can be guaranteed by using the withdrawn version of the standard. The presumption of conformity is valid until a corresponding amendment is published in the Official Journal of the European Union.

This International Standard specifies technical requirements for windows, hatches, portlights, deadlights and doors, taking into account the type and the location of the appliance and design category
